An innovative 3D Volumetric module for rendering and interactively displaying atmospheric data in its real three-dimensional and temporal environment.
The 3DV-Cube allows users to render and interactively display, pan, zoom, rotate and pivot a selected column of 3D atmospheric information. Users can perform surface cross-sections and animations in time to appreciate local and varying weather situations at any location and altitude.
It is particularly powerful for analyzing volumetric atmospheric data from Numerical Weather Prediction models, radar networks and other 3D data sources, providing forecasters and meteorologists with tools that go far beyond traditional 2D map display.
Render and interactively display a selected column of 3D atmospheric information. Pan, zoom, rotate and pivot through volumetric weather data with ease.
Perform surface cross-sections through any axis of the 3D data cube to reveal internal atmospheric structures and vertical profiles at any point.
Animate weather data through time in full 3D — appreciate how local and regional weather situations evolve across time within the volumetric environment.
Render Numerical Weather Prediction model outputs in gridded point value or symbol, isolines and isosurfaces for precise quantitative analysis.
Easy-to-use quantitative and information-retrieval tools to enhance qualitative visualizations with precise data values at any 3D location.
The 3DV-Cube is designed for professionals who need to go beyond traditional 2D map displays and work directly with volumetric atmospheric data.
